Study on the formation of MgB2 phase
Qing-rong Feng, Chinping Chen, Jun Xu, Ling-wen Kong, Xiu Chen, Yong-zhong Wang, Zheng-xiang Gao
Abstract
We report the study of the polycrystalline MgB2 phase formation during the fabrication processes. Three major phases are identified in different sintering temperature ranges according to the corresponding superconducting properties and the crystalization conditions. The optimum fabrication parameters are obtained for the MgB2 superconducting phase formation.
